void DisplayHelp()
{
        TCHAR szHelp[] =
                                        TEXT("Copyright (c) Microsoft Corporation, 2000-2001. All rights reserved.\n")
                                        TEXT("\n")
                                        TEXT("MsiStuff will display or update the resources \n")
                                        TEXT(" in the setup.exe boot strap executable\n")
                                        TEXT("\n")
                                        TEXT("[MsiStuff Command Line Syntax]\n")
                                        TEXT(" Display Properties->> msistuff setup.exe \n")
                                        TEXT(" Set Properties    ->> msistuff setup.exe option {data} ... \n")
                                        TEXT("\n")
                                        TEXT("[MsiStuff Options -- Multiple specifications are allowed]\n")
                                        TEXT(" BaseURL                             - /u {value} \n")
                                        TEXT(" Msi                                 - /d {value} \n")
                                        TEXT(" Product Name                        - /n {value} \n")
                                        TEXT(" Minimum Msi Version                 - /v {value} \n")
                                        TEXT(" InstMsi URL Location                - /i {value} \n")
                                        TEXT(" InstMsiA                            - /a {value} \n")
                                        TEXT(" InstMsiW                            - /w {value} \n")
                                        TEXT(" Patch                               - /m {value} \n")
                                        TEXT(" Operation                           - /o {value} \n")
                                        TEXT(" Properties (PROPERTY=VALUE strings) - /p {value} \n")
                                        TEXT("\n")
                                        TEXT("If an option is specified multiple times, the last one wins\n")
                                        TEXT("\n")
                                        TEXT("/p must be last on the command line.  The remainder of\n")
                                        TEXT("the command line is considered a part of the {value}\n")
                                        TEXT("This also means that /p cannot be specified multiple times\n");
        _tprintf(szHelp);
}

//_____________________________________________________________________________________________________
//
// SkipWhiteSpace
//
//       Skips whitespace in the string and returns next non-tab non-whitespace charcter 
//_____________________________________________________________________________________________________

TCHAR SkipWhiteSpace(TCHAR*& rpch)
{
        TCHAR ch;
        for (; (ch = *rpch) == TEXT(' ') || ch == TEXT('\t'); rpch++)
                ;
        return ch;
}

//_____________________________________________________________________________________________________
//
// SkipValue
//
//       Skips over the value of a switch and returns true if a value was present. Handles value enclosed
//       in quotation marks
//_____________________________________________________________________________________________________

bool SkipValue(TCHAR*& rpch)
{
        TCHAR ch = *rpch;
        if (ch == 0 || ch == TEXT('/') || ch == TEXT('-'))
                return false;   // no value present
        for (int i = 0; (ch = *rpch) != TEXT(' ') && ch != TEXT('\t') && ch != 0; rpch++, i++)
        {
                if (0 == i && *rpch == TEXT('"'))
                {
                        rpch++; // for '"'
                        for (; (ch = *rpch) != TEXT('"') && ch != 0; rpch++)
                                ;
                        ch = *(++rpch);
                        break;
                }
        }
        if (ch != 0)
                *rpch++ = 0;
        return true;
}

//_____________________________________________________________________________________________________
//
// RemoveQuotes
//
//  Removes enclosing quotation marks for the value. Assumes lpStripped is sufficiently sized.  Returns
//  if no enclosing quotation mark at front of string.
//_____________________________________________________________________________________________________

void RemoveQuotes(LPCTSTR lpOriginal, LPTSTR lpStripped)
{
        bool fEnclosedInQuotes = false;

        const TCHAR *pchOrig = lpOriginal;

        // check for "
        if (*pchOrig == TEXT('"'))
        {
                fEnclosedInQuotes = true;
                pchOrig++;
        }
        
        lstrcpy(lpStripped, pchOrig);

        if (!fEnclosedInQuotes)
                return;

        TCHAR *pch = lpStripped + lstrlen(lpStripped) + 1; // start at NULL

        pch = CharPrev(lpStripped, pch);

        // look for trailing "
        while (pch != lpStripped)
        {
                if (*pch == TEXT('"'))
                {
                        *pch = 0;
                        break; // only care about trailing ", and not quotes in middle
                }
                pch = CharPrev(lpStripped, pch);
        }
}
